Smartctl Open Device Dev Sda Failed Dell Or Megaraid Controller Please Try Adding 39d Megaraid N 39 Extra Quality May 2026
The error message "smartctl open device: /dev/sda failed: DELL or MegaRAID controller, please try adding '-d megaraid,N'" occurs because smartctl is trying to talk directly to a virtual RAID volume (e.g., /dev/sda) instead of the physical hard drives hidden behind the controller.
Run a short self-test on physical disk #0: The error message "smartctl open device: /dev/sda failed:
-d: The flag tellingsmartctlto specify the device type.megaraid: The driver type for Dell PERC/Lsi MegaRAID cards.N: A variable representing the physical drive number.
smartctl open device /dev/sda failed: Dell or MegaRAID controller. Please try adding '-d megaraid,N' -d : The flag telling smartctl to specify the device type
SMART Health Status: OK
Method 3: Use lsblk + inference – less reliable, but if you have 4 drives in RAID10, IDs 0 and 1 are likely the first mirror pair. smartctl open device /dev/sda failed: Dell or MegaRAID